set uzaklıklar (Transact-sql)

Uzaklığı (konumuna göre başlangıç deyimi) belirtilen anahtar sözcükleri döndürür Transact-SQLdb kitaplık uygulamaları için deyimleri.

Önemli notÖnemli

Bu özellik Microsoft SQL Server'ın ilerideki bir sürümünde kaldırılacaktır. Yeni geliştirme işlerinde bu özelliği kullanmaktan kaçının ve bu özelliği kullanmakta olan uygulamalarda değişiklik yapmayı planlayın.

Konu bağlantısı simgesi Transact-SQL Sözdizim Kuralları

Sözdizimi

SET OFFSETS keyword_list { ON | OFF }

Bağımsız değişkenler

  • keyword_list
    Virgülle ayrılmış bir listesini Transact-SQLyapıları da dahil olmak üzere, sipariş, TABLOSUNDAKİ yordamı, deyimi, param, seçin ve İDAM.

Açıklamalar

set uzaklıklar sadece db Kitaplığı uygulamalarında kullanılır.

set uzaklıklar ayarı ayrıştırma saati ayarlamak ve hiçbir zaman yürütme veya çalışma süresi. Ayarı ayrıştırma zaman set deyimi toplu iş veya saklı yordam içinde varsa, ayar ne olursa olsun, ister kod yürütülmesine aslında bu noktaya ulaşır etkisi olur anlamına gelir; ve herhangi deyimleri çalıştırılır önce set deyimi etkinleşir. Örneğin, bir ise set deyimi bile...BAŞKA hiçbir zaman hala set deyimi yürütme sırasında ulaşıldığında deyimi bloğu alır etkisi nedeniyle IF...else deyimi bloğu ayrıştırılır.

set uzaklıklar bir saklı yordam ayarlarsanız, Denetim saklı yordam döndürülen sonra set ofset değerini geri yüklenir. Bu nedenle, dinamik sql içinde belirtilen bir set uzaklıklar deyimi dinamik sql deyimini izleyen herhangi deyimleri üzerinde herhangi bir etkisi yok.

set parseonly uzaklıklar seçeneği on olarak ve hiçbir hata ortaya uzaklıklar verir.

İzinler

Üyelik Genel rolü.

Ayrıca bkz.

Başvuru

Deyimiyle (Transact-sql) bırak

set parseonly (Transact-sql)